The current demographic situation in Azerbaijan is positive, while the population size of the country is expected to reach 12 million people by 2050.

The Labor and Social Protection Ministry reported about this, as the issues of demographic situation as well as aging of the population and gender ratio distortion were high on agenda during the event organized in the ministry.

Representatives of relevant state structures, including Centre for Strategic Studies, Ombudsman Apparatus, UN Population Fund, National Academy of Sciences as well as international experts participated in the meeting.

Participants mentioned that a positive demographic situation in the country, as well as stable population upsurge is a result of the socio-economic development strategy pursued by the state.

“Population of the country has grown by 18 percent since 2003. The current figure reaches 9,755,000. Birth rate in the country was at the level of 14 children in a thousand, while the figure increased up to 17 in 2015”

Reduction of the death rate from 6 to 5.7 percent in the country last year is considered to be yet another reason of positive indices. Moreover, reduction was also observed in infant and child mortality rate.

Positive dynamics was also recorded in life expectancy of the country's population.

 “Life expectancy rate stood at 72.3 years in 2003 (69.5 for men and 75.1 for women), while the figure increase up to 75.2 (72.7 for men and 77.6 for women) in 2015”

Moreover, the number of human resources in the reported period grew by 29 percent.
